Operatives of Nigeria’s Department of State Services (DSS) have arrested former Minister of Science and Technology Uche Nnaji over allegations of certificate forgery.
Nnaji was reportedly arrested on Wednesday at the Akanu Ibiam International Airport in Enugu while preparing to board a private jet to Abuja.
Security sources said the arrest was carried out at the request of the Independent Corrupt Practices and Other Related Offences Commission (ICPC). He was later handed over to the anti-corruption agency for further investigation.
According to the sources, the ICPC had previously invited the former minister several times following petitions linked to both the certificate forgery allegations and his management of the ministry. The commission reportedly sought the DSS’s assistance after those invitations.
The ICPC has not yet issued an official statement on the arrest, while Nnaji has not publicly responded to the allegations.
